I have four grandkids, and 2 step grandkids. My four grandkids occasionally play video games but it's not a big deal for them. My two step grandkids play them constantly. The difference is, the stepgrandkid's parents work all the time, and when they're not working they're doing their on things, leaving the kids up in their rooms. The grandkids parents are constantly interacting with their kids: talking, laughing, yelling, screaming, in-their-face. Those kids may be pissed off at their parents much of the time, but they are going somewhere. Somewhere real.
